How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Ponce de Leon?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Ponce de Leon Studio Apartments | $1,867 | $1,200 | $3,849 |
Ponce de Leon 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,219 | $995 | $4,502 |
Ponce de Leon 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,020 | $1,500 | $6,196 |
Ponce de Leon 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,712 | $1,895 | $6,610 |
Ponce de Leon 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,941 | $2,480 | $3,549 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Ponce de Leon Apartments with EV Charging
What is the Cheapest EV Charging apartment in Ponce de Leon?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in Ponce de Leon with EV Charging is at The Wayland listed at $1,369.
How much is the average rent for Ponce de Leon Apartments with EV Charging?
The average rent for a Apartment in Ponce de Leon with EV Charging is $2,991.
What is the largest Ponce de Leon Apartment for rent with EV Charging?
Today's Apartment with EV Charging and the most square footage in Ponce de Leon is a 1,334 square feet unit starting from $1,825 at Vantage St. Pete.
What is the average size for Ponce de Leon Apartments for rent with EV Charging?
The average size for a rental with EV Charging in Ponce de Leon is currently at 523 sq ft.
